原文:深入淺出C#結構體——封裝以太網心跳包的結構為例

目錄 .應用背景 .結構體解析 . .結構體存在棧中 . .結構體不需要手動釋放 .封裝心跳包結構體 .結構體靜態幫助類 .New出來的結構體是存在堆中還是棧中 . .不帶形參的結構體構造 . .帶形參的結構體構造 .性能測試 .原因分析 .下一篇:類與結構體性能對比測試 以封裝網絡心跳包為例 .IL工具使用分享 .應用背景 底端設備有大量網絡報文 字節數組 :心跳報文,數據采集報文,告警報文上 ...

2020-03-31 17:55 2 1606 推薦指數:

查看詳情

以太網結構

以太網結構 第一個是以太網Ⅱ幀結構 Ethernet_II 的幀中各字段說明如下: 以太網Ⅰ幀 ...

Wed Oct 20 07:58:00 CST 2021 0 171
以太網結構

OSI模型及TCP/IP:        數據封裝:        應用數據需要經過TCP/IP每一層處理之后才能通過網絡傳輸到目的端,每一層上都使用該層的協議數據單元PDU(Protocol Data Unit)彼此交換信息。不同層的PDU中包含不同的信息 ...

Thu Sep 05 23:56:00 CST 2019 0 1233
以太網結構

網絡通信協議 一般地,關注於邏輯數據關系的協議通常被稱為上層協議,而關注於物理數據流的協議通常被稱為低層協議。 IEEE802就是一套用來管理物理數據流在局域中傳輸的標准,包括在局域中傳輸物理數據的802.3以太網標准。還有一些用來管理物理數據流在使用串行介質的廣域中傳輸的標准 ...

Sat Jul 30 07:39:00 CST 2016 0 11693
以太網結構

以太網結構 以太網上使用兩種標准幀格式。第一種是上世紀80年代初提出的DIX v2格式,即Ethernet II幀格式。Ethernet II后來被IEEE 802標准接納,並寫進了IEEE 802.3x-1997的3.2.6節。第二種是1983年提出的IEEE 802.3格式。這兩種格式 ...

Tue Aug 17 02:24:00 CST 2021 0 145
千兆以太網(4):發送——組建以太網心跳

  心跳就是在客戶端和服務器間定時通知對方自己狀態的一個自己定義的命令字,按照一定的時間間隔發送,類似於心跳,所以叫做心跳心跳包在GPRS通信和CDMA通信的應用方面使用非常廣泛。數據網關會定時清理沒有數據的路由,心跳通常設定在30-40秒之間。所謂的心跳就是客戶端定時發送簡單的信息 ...

Tue Dec 24 03:08:00 CST 2019 0 750
以太網結構詳解

網絡通信協議 一般地,關注於邏輯數據關系的協議通常被稱為上層協議,而關注於物理數據流的協議通常被稱為低層協議。 IEEE802就是一套用來管理物理數據流在局域中傳輸的標准,包括在局域中傳輸物理數據的802.3以太網標准。還有一些用來管理物理數據流在使用串行介質的廣域中傳輸 ...

Thu Jun 06 17:41:00 CST 2019 0 14072
常見以太網結構

常見的以太網結構由ETHERNET II 和 IEEE802.3。 ETHERNET II 數據鏈路層幀格式 IEEE802.3數據鏈路層幀格式 Ethernet II和IEEE802.3的幀格式比較類似,主要的不同點在於前者定義的2字節的類型,而后者定義的是2字節的長度 ...

Tue Oct 17 16:45:00 CST 2017 0 6248
以太網數據、IP、TCP/UDP 結構(轉)

源:以太網數據、IP、TCP/UDP 結構 結構" src="http://s5.sinaimg.cn/middle/4ed9fbabnc0ffc557bd24&690" alt="以太網數據、IP、TCP/UDP 結構" name ...

Wed Aug 05 18:34:00 CST 2015 0 6835
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M